Scan and recognize software: top 10 benefits

As an organization, you regularly have to deal with the processing of incoming invoices. An optical character recognition software is an easy way to process these. Your mailboxes in which invoices come in are linked to your business environment. The scan and recognize software automatically downloads and scans the purchase invoice using OCR and identifies which invoice fields are relevant. Webinar: administration of the new ‘Gasketelwet’ & SCIOS Scope 12

Administration in your business software for the ‘Gasketelwet’ & SCIOS Scope 12 The service and installation industry is currently facing two significant changes. Gas boiler installers have had to deal with the new Gasketelwet since the end of 2020, and solar panel installers have had to deal with the SCIOS Scope 12 inspection since the spring of 2021.
